Alex Snipsner with red carpet polka starting gets off on
this episode of Tom's Bulka Party. Well, this weekend is
the International Polka Association's fifty seventh annual International Polka Festival
out there at the Double Tree Hilton Pittsburgh, Cranberry in Mars, Pennsylvania.
(03:05):
So great talent comes in that weekend for that wonderful
festival and convention for the International Polka Association the IPA.
And at this festival they honor the recipients of the
twenty twenty four Music Awards and the twenty twenty five
inductees into the International Polk Association Hall of Fame. And
(03:27):
there's four days of celebration out there. They started Thursday
with Alex Meikester out there at the Cranberry Elks Club.
He's done that for three or four years in a
row now, and a lot of people enjoy Alex having
fun out there. They call that the kickoff party on Thursday,
and then Friday they have the welcome Party this year
John Stevens and Double Shot where they're Friday from one
(03:51):
to four and then music from many Foreman's Orchestra of
the National Talent and Polka Country Musicians. Saturday, August thirtieth,
Pool Party with Twin City Sounds and music from Frankielushka
and Blue Magic, the IPA tribute band, Clinic and Friends,
and a special appearance from Molly b And. On Sunday,
Polka Mass starts at ten the annual election of all
(04:11):
the Officers and the Convention meeting. Pool Party with mon
Valley Bush Des Pluski and Meischer's Men, Michael Cossa and
the Beat, the Music Company, and the Polka Family Band
Roalm things out. The International Polk Association having lots of
fun out there.
